The mangalica conquers in Japan
The Hungarian Mangalitsa conquers the Japanese market. Started in Michelin-starred restaurants, it is considered more prominent than the world's coolest meat products. The Hungarian Mangalitsa targets Korea, Hong Kong and Singapore.
Dezső, the stuffed, curly blond Mangalitsa had a great success in early May in Hong Kong. It was its umpteenth appearance in the Far East, where it was exhibited at the largest food fairs.
The Japanese found the curly pig beautiful and interesting, and they want to know everything about it: where does it come from, what does it eat, how to prepare it in Hungary, why is it so special – these are the most typical questions. (origo, Fekete Emese)
